What is an Island Hood Extractor?
An island hood extractor is a kind of range hood that is suspended from the ceiling above a kitchen island. Unlike wall-mounted hoods, which are usually connected to a wall above the cooktop, island hoods work as a central function, offering both functional and design advantages. They are primarily used to filter out smoke, steam, grease, and cooking odors originating from stovetops.

Setting up an island hood extractor requires careful planning to guarantee ideal efficiency and visual appeal. Here are some critical points to consider:
Height from Cooktop: The hood must be set up at an appropriate height above the cooktop-- generally around 30 to 36 inches-- to make sure effective air flow.
Ducting Requirements: Determine whether the hood will be ducted or ductless. Ducted models need access to an exterior wall or roofing system for venting.
Ceiling Height: Measure the best ceiling extractor fan kitchen island height to choose a hood that fits well. Some hoods come with adjustable lengths.
Electrical and Gas Lines: Ensure that electrical and gas connections are safely set up and accessible for the new hood.
Expert Installation: Engaging a professional to set up the hood can guarantee proper setup and functionality, particularly for ducted hoods.

The size of the hood must match the width of your cooking surface. For optimal efficiency, objective for a hood that is at least as wide as the stovetop.
How do I know if I need a ducted or ductless island hood?
If your kitchen enables venting outdoors, a ducted design is chosen for better air quality. Pick ductless if venting is not possible or if you want a simpler setup.
Just how much CFM do I need for my island hood extractor?
As a basic rule, determine CFM by multiplying the width of the stove by 10, or follow the maker's recommendations. For high-output cooking, search for higher CFM rankings.
Can I set up an island hood myself?
While some may try DIY setup, due to the complexity, it is suggested to work with an expert for ducted installations to guarantee safe and effective operation.
